![]() ![]() Author: Sparrow Giles Publisher: edizioni Dedalo Dal Sistema Solare fino ai confini più estremi dell'Universo, 50 grandi idee astronomia descrive il cosmo in cui viviamo, raccontandone la storia e descrivendone i misteri. Come ha avuto inizio l'Universo? Cosa succede nel cuore di un buco nero? Perché le onde gravitazionali, rivelate sperimentalmente soltanto un secolo dopo essere state previste dalla teoria della relatività generale, sono così importanti? Ognuno dei 50 brevi capitoli dell'affascinante libro di Giles Sparrow è dedicato a chiarire i concetti, le scoperte e i segreti della storia dell'astronomia e della cosmologia. Grazie anche all'aiuto di disegni, cronologie e riquadri di approfondimento, il volume esplora la natura e la varietà del cosmo, appagando le curiosità del lettore e suscitando sempre nuove domande, alcune delle quali (come la natura della materia e dell'energia oscure) ancora in attesa di risposta. € 20,00

![]() ![]() Author: Sparrow Giles Publisher: Quercus What happens when a star dies? How many asteroids are in our solar system? Can galaxies collide? What is dark energy?Astronomy in Minutes answers all these questions and more as it condenses 200 key concepts into easily digestible essays. From Trojan asteroids to stellar black holes, and from superclusters to cosmic microwave background, this book will take you on an essential tour around the universe. Beginning with the specks and constellations that we see in the night sky, and then zooming in on the objects and matter" beyond the naked eye, Astronomy in Minutes draws on established theories and recent research. Each essay is accompanied by an image or a clear diagram to help unravel complex ideas. Beginning with the constellations and finishing with the latest cosmological theories, this is the perfect reference guide to this fascinating subject. Contents include: The celestial sphere, Piscis Austrinus, the Earth-Moon system, Io and Ganymede, Kuiper Belt Objects, Measuring stellar properties, Nuclear fusion, Red and orange dwarfs, Open star clusters, Planetary nebulae, Supernova remnants, Cosmic expansion, Quasars and blazars, Nature of spacetime, Nucleosynthesis and the Anthropic Principle. € 12,00

![]() ![]() Author: Sparrow Giles Publisher: Quercus Mars has always fascinated humanity and the findings of the past decade have revolutionized ideas about our nearest neighbor--revealing its watery past and geological similarity to Earth. This gorgeously illustrated volume is filled with the latest and most magnificent images to be sent back from Curiosity, will walk you in the footsteps of the NASA probes and rovers that have been surveying the planet from 1964 until the present day. Experience its other-worldly beauty as you hover over sinister dust devils, immense icecaps and textured rock formations. Mars charts an incredible course across this unfamiliar planet, depicting all sides, seasons, channels and chasms, from the North Pole to the Southern Highlands. Witness the soaring heights of Olympus Mons--the tallest volcano in the Solar System--watch a giant dust storm tear through the canyons of the Valles Marineris, and explore the broad valleys of Chryse Planitia, scarred from catastrophic floods. Detailed and accessible essays explain how Mars was formed, shedding light on its internal and external structure, weather systems and unique geographical features, as well as on the compelling evidence of water and microscopic life. Each image is accompanied by a caption that explains in unparalleled detail the abstract patterns and peculiar geology that form this majestic planet. € 27,70
